Advantages of Buying Used Bedroom Furniture



Cost Savings


One of the primary reasons consumers turn to used furniture is the significant cost savings. Pre-owned pieces can cost anywhere from 30% to 70% less than new items, making it an attractive option for students, young professionals, or families on a budget.

Unique and Vintage Styles


Used furniture often features vintage or antique designs that are no longer available in mainstream stores. These pieces can add character and charm to your bedroom, creating a distinctive aesthetic that reflects personality and taste.

Environmental Benefits


Buying used furniture is an eco-friendly choice as it reduces waste and the demand for new manufacturing. Reusing existing furniture decreases the environmental footprint associated with production, transportation, and packaging.

High-Quality Options


Many used furniture items are made from durable materials like solid wood, which can outlast modern composite or particleboard alternatives. This means you can find high-quality, long-lasting pieces at a fraction of the cost.

Types of Used Bedroom Furniture



Beds and Mattresses


- Platform beds and canopy beds often appear in used furniture markets.
- Antique or vintage beds can add a timeless appeal.
- When buying used mattresses, it's important to check for cleanliness, firmness, and signs of wear. Consider replacing mattresses for hygiene reasons unless they are relatively new and well-maintained.

Dressers and Wardrobes


- Essential for clothing storage, used dressers come in various styles from modern to vintage.
- Wardrobes are ideal for larger spaces or those seeking a more classic look.
- Check for structural integrity, drawer functionality, and signs of wood damage.

Nightstands and Bedside Tables


- Small but functional, used nightstands can complement larger furniture pieces.
- Look for stability, surface condition, and compatibility with your bed.

Mirrors and Vanity Tables


- Used mirrors can add elegance and functionality.
- Ensure the mirror’s glass is intact, and the frame is free from cracks or damage.

Additional Storage Options


- Under-bed storage units, shelving, or armoires can maximize space in a bedroom.

Tips for Buying Used Bedroom Furniture



Assess Condition Carefully


- Check for structural integrity: look for wobbling, loose joints, or cracks.
- Examine surfaces for scratches, stains, or water damage.
- Test drawers and doors for smooth operation.

Measure Your Space and Furniture


- Ensure the furniture fits comfortably within your bedroom layout.
- Take measurements of your space and compare with the item dimensions.

Verify Authenticity and Quality


- For vintage or antique pieces, request provenance or authenticity certificates if available.
- Inspect the type of wood and craftsmanship quality.

Negotiate Price


- Don’t hesitate to bargain, especially if you notice minor damages or repairs needed.
- Consider total costs, including transportation or restoration.

Consider Future Renovation


- Slightly damaged or outdated furniture can often be restored or refinished to match your decor.

Maintenance and Care of Used Bedroom Furniture



Cleaning and Upkeep


- Regular dusting with a soft cloth helps maintain surface appearance.
- Use appropriate cleaning products based on the material (wood, metal, upholstery).

Refinishing and Repairs


- Sanding and polishing can revive worn wood surfaces.
- Replace damaged hardware or upholstery as needed.

Protection Measures


- Use coasters, placemats, or bedspreads to prevent scratches and stains.
- Keep furniture away from direct sunlight and humidity to prevent warping or fading.

Long-Term Storage Tips


- Cover furniture with breathable fabric when not in use.
- Store in a dry, climate-controlled environment to prevent deterioration.
